Skip to content
Home » Mongodb Lookup? The 19 Top Answers

Mongodb Lookup? The 19 Top Answers

Are you looking for an answer to the topic “mongodb lookup“? We answer all your questions at the website Budget-template.com in category: Latest technology and computer news updates for you. You will find the answer right below.

Keep Reading

Mongodb Lookup
Mongodb Lookup

Table of Contents

What is MongoDB lookup?

The MongoDB Lookup operator, by definition, “Performs a left outer join to an unshared collection in the same database to filter in documents from the “joined” collection for processing.” Simply put, using the MongoDB Lookup operator makes it possible to merge data from the document you are running a query on and the …

What is pipeline in lookup in MongoDB?

In MongoDB, a correlated subquery is a pipeline in a $lookup stage that references document fields from a joined collection. An uncorrelated subquery does not reference joined fields.


MongoDB $lookup Example | The MongoDB Aggregation Pipeline

MongoDB $lookup Example | The MongoDB Aggregation Pipeline
MongoDB $lookup Example | The MongoDB Aggregation Pipeline

Images related to the topicMongoDB $lookup Example | The MongoDB Aggregation Pipeline

Mongodb $Lookup Example | The Mongodb Aggregation Pipeline
Mongodb $Lookup Example | The Mongodb Aggregation Pipeline

How do I map two collections in MongoDB?

For performing MongoDB Join two collections, you must use the $lookup operator. It is defined as a stage that executes a left outer join with another collection and aids in filtering data from joined documents. For example, if a user requires all grades from all students, then the below query can be written: Students.

See also  Mongodb Import Csv? The 17 Detailed Answer

Can we use $lookup on same collection?

The $lookup operator is an aggregation operator or an aggregation stage, which is used to join a document from one collection to a document of another collection of the same database based on some queries. Both the collections should belong to the same databases.

What is Atlas data lake?

About Atlas Data Lake

MongoDB Atlas Data Lake allows you to natively query, transform, and move data across AWS S3 and MongoDB Atlas clusters. You can query your richly structured data stored in JSON, BSON, CSV, TSV, Avro, ORC, and Parquet formats using the mongo shell, MongoDB Compass, or any MongoDB driver.

Is MongoDB free to use?

MongoDB Community is the source available and free to use edition of MongoDB. MongoDB Enterprise is available as part of the MongoDB Enterprise Advanced subscription and includes comprehensive support for your MongoDB deployment.

What is aggregation in MongoDB?

In MongoDB, aggregation operations process the data records/documents and return computed results. It collects values from various documents and groups them together and then performs different types of operations on that grouped data like sum, average, minimum, maximum, etc to return a computed result.


See some more details on the topic mongodb lookup here:


$lookup Examples | MongoDB – StackChief

$lookup allows you to perform joins on collections in the same database. $lookup works by returning documents from a “joined” collection as a sub-array of the …

+ Read More

MongoDB Lookup Aggregations: Syntax, Usage & Practical …

The MongoDB lookup operator, by definition, leverages the left outer join method to merge information from one document to another. Using the $ …

+ View More Here

MongoDB lookup using Node.js – GeeksforGeeks

The $lookup operator is an aggregation operator or an aggregation stage, which is used to join a document from one collection to a document …

+ Read More

$lookup (aggregation) — MongoDB Manual 3.4

Specifies the field from the documents in the from collection. $lookup performs an equality match on the foreignField to the localField from the input documents …

+ Read More Here

How fetch data from two tables in MongoDB?

In MongoDB, we can combine data of multiple collections into one through the $lookup aggregation stage. In this, you have to specify which collection you want to join with the current collection and select the field that matches in both the collection.

What is $project in MongoDB?

Description. The $project function in MongoDB passes along the documents with only the specified fields to the next stage in the pipeline. This may be the existing fields from the input documents or newly computed fields. Syntax: { $project: { <specifications> } }

See also  G-Technology ArmorATD Review: How does the new armored drive hold up? g technology armoratd

How do I join two tables in NoSQL?

Natively, unfortunately, is not possible to perform a Join into a NoSQL database. This is actually one of the biggest differences between SQL and NoSQL DBs. As @kaleb said, you would have to do multiple selections and then join the needed information “manually”.

How fetch all data from collection in MongoDB?

Fetch all data from the collection

If we want to fetch all documents from the collection the following mongodb command can be used : >db. userdetails. find(); or >db.

Can you do joins in MongoDB?

Fortunately, MongoDB Joins can be performed in MongoDB 3.2 as it introduces a new Lookup operation that can perform Join operations on Collections.


The $lookup Stage – MongoDB Aggregation Framework

The $lookup Stage – MongoDB Aggregation Framework
The $lookup Stage – MongoDB Aggregation Framework

Images related to the topicThe $lookup Stage – MongoDB Aggregation Framework

The $Lookup Stage - Mongodb Aggregation Framework
The $Lookup Stage – Mongodb Aggregation Framework

What is $in in MongoDB?

Introduction to the MongoDB $in operator

The $in is a comparison query operator that allows you to select documents where the value of a field is equal to any value in an array.

How do I join two tables in MongoDB?

Join Collections

MongoDB is not a relational database, but you can perform a left outer join by using the $lookup stage. The $lookup stage lets you specify which collection you want to join with the current collection, and which fields that should match.

What is unwind in MongoDB?

What is MongoDB $unwind? The MongoDB $unwind operator is used to deconstruct an array field in a document and create separate output documents for each item in the array.

Is MongoDB good for data warehouse?

In many cases, the MongoDB data platform provides enough support for analytics that a data warehouse or a data lake is not required. Some of the features that MongoDB provides to support analytics include: A powerful aggregation pipeline that allows for data to be aggregated and analyzed in real time.

What is a data lake in MongoDB?

Overview. Atlas Data Lake is MongoDB’s solution for querying data stored in low cost S3 buckets, Atlas clusters, and HTTP Stores using the MongoDB Query Language. This allows applications to store data in the appropriate storage solution for its use-case.

How does MongoDB work with AWS?

MongoDB is an open source, NoSQL database that provides support for JSON-styled, document-oriented storage systems. It supports a flexible data model that enables you to store data of any structure, and provides a rich set of features, including full index support, sharding, and replication.

Why use MongoDB vs SQL?

SQL databases are used to store structured data while NoSQL databases like MongoDB are used to save unstructured data. MongoDB is used to save unstructured data in JSON format. MongoDB does not support advanced analytics and joins like SQL databases support.

See also  Mongodb Field Name? All Answers

Is MongoDB better than SQL Server?

Conclusion. MongoDB is a database that is more advanced and capable of handling big data with dynamic schema features. SQL Server is an RDBMS that is used to manage the relational database system and offers end-to-end business data solutions. In the case of unstructured data MongoDB is a good choice.

Is MongoDB faster than SQL?

MongoDB is more fast and scalable in comparison to the SQL server. MongoDB doesn’t support JOIN and Global transactions but the SQL server supports it. MongoDB supports a big amount of data but the MS SQL server doesn’t.

What is sharding in MongoDB?

Sharding is a method for distributing data across multiple machines. MongoDB uses sharding to support deployments with very large data sets and high throughput operations. Database systems with large data sets or high throughput applications can challenge the capacity of a single server.


Lookup within an array and Lookup between multiple collections with Project | Lookup in MongoDB

Lookup within an array and Lookup between multiple collections with Project | Lookup in MongoDB
Lookup within an array and Lookup between multiple collections with Project | Lookup in MongoDB

Images related to the topicLookup within an array and Lookup between multiple collections with Project | Lookup in MongoDB

Lookup Within An Array And Lookup Between Multiple Collections With Project | Lookup In Mongodb
Lookup Within An Array And Lookup Between Multiple Collections With Project | Lookup In Mongodb

What is MongoDB indexing?

An index in MongoDB is a special data structure that holds the data of few fields of documents on which the index is created. Indexes improve the speed of search operations in database because instead of searching the whole document, the search is performed on the indexes that holds only few fields.

What is mapReduce in MongoDB?

Map-reduce is a data processing paradigm for condensing large volumes of data into useful aggregated results. To perform map-reduce operations, MongoDB provides the mapReduce database command.

Related searches to mongodb lookup

  • spring data mongodb lookup pipeline
  • mongodb lookup pipeline example
  • aggregate mongodb lookup
  • mongodb lookup multiple collections
  • mongodb lookup performance
  • mongodb lookup examples
  • mongodb lookup if exists
  • mongodb node.js lookup
  • mongodb lookup pipeline ( ( $match))
  • mongodb lookup project
  • mongodb nested lookup
  • mongodb lookup match
  • mongodb lookup multiple fields
  • mongodb aggregate lookup match
  • mongodb conditional lookup
  • mongodb lookup array
  • mongodb aggregate lookup
  • c# mongodb lookup
  • mongodb lookup with condition
  • mongodb lookup select fields
  • mongodb multiple lookup
  • mongodb lookup nested array
  • mongodb lookup same collection

Information related to the topic mongodb lookup

Here are the search results of the thread mongodb lookup from Bing. You can read more if you want.


You have just come across an article on the topic mongodb lookup. If you found this article useful, please share it. Thank you very much.

Leave a Reply

Your email address will not be published.